Fingerstick blood exam. You will use a Exclusive very small needle referred to as a lancet to prick the facet of one's fingertip. Then, you can expect to squeeze a little fall of blood over a disposable screening strip so it could be study by a portable gadget termed a blood glucose meter. In just some seconds, a screen will Screen your blood sugar stage.

Should you have diabetic issues, you'll likely will need to examine your blood glucose on a daily basis to be sure that your blood glucose numbers are as part of your focus on array. Some individuals may have to check their blood glucose a number of times per day. Inquire your well being care crew how often you need to check it.
